HR20 thru HR23 CE Release 1/7 v.046B
ADVERTS 1
Systems in this CE
HR20-100 • HR20-700
HR21-100 • HR21-200 • HR21-700
HR22-100 • R22-100 • R22-200
HR21Pro • HR23-700
Window of opportunity to download:
Friday, January 7, 2011 11:00PM - 2:30AM ET
Saturday, January 8, 2011 11:00PM - 2:30AM ET
Risk Level for this Download:
High Risk
New features
Enhanced Channel Banner!
Improved/Updated
Under the hood
Notes
Please do not report sluggish issues or missing search results within the first 12 hours after download.
Keyword search UTUB3ON is required for YouTube.
It can take up to 2 hours to enable YouTube and Trailers functionality after running the keyword searches.

Updating my "new" (refurb) hr21-700 to 046B. Was reeeeeeeaaaaalllllly hoping D* would be extra nice and ship me something a little newer than this thing to replace my now busted hr21-200. So much for that idea.
One off topic question for you guys in the know. I was using an EHD, are all my shows toast? The CSR said no, but I am assuming she was "un-informed" to say the politest thing I can think of. When I plugged my EHD into the new box, it tells me all my shows are either corrupted or failed to record, or something like that. Am I totally hosed, as I had 75% or a 1tb drive full of movies.

Your movies are toast. All recordings are encrypted so that only the dvr that recorded them can play them.

Proud Staff MemberYou say they shipped you a new receiver. The recordings on the hard drive are locked to the receiver they were recorded on. If you move the drive to a different receiver (or a receiver is replaced) it will format the drive upon bootup. If it doesn't format the drive, it will show the recordings but will not play them, which leaves you needing to do a reboot and erase to format the drive so you can use it again.
